Skill and balance issues: Some skills change significantly when upgraded, leading to sudden shifts in gameplay. Additionally, there are issues with skill balance and the effectiveness of certain abilities.
Translation and text problems: The game suffers from various translation errors, inconsistencies, and untranslated texts. Some text also remains in Chinese, indicating incomplete localization.
Insufficient and shallow story: The game's story is criticized for being insufficient and not engaging. Players feel that there is a lack of content and depth in the narrative.
High damage and low survivability: Players frequently report that the game has high damage output from enemies, making it difficult to survive. Environmental hazards and enemy attacks often deal significant damage, and the game's survival mechanics are insufficient.
Optimization and performance problems: The game has optimization issues that affect performance. Players report the need for better optimization in various areas.

Performance and frame rate issues: Multiple players reported frame drops, performance problems, and the need for optimization. These issues are prevalent across various devices and scenarios.
Game stability and crashes: Players experienced game freezing, frequent crashes, and stability issues. Specific mentions include crashes during loading saves and black screen crashes.
High resource consumption: The game has high CPU and GPU usage, leading to overheating and excessive fan noise. This includes issues like GPU running at full capacity even on the title screen.
Visual and display issues: Various visual errors were reported, including color correction issues, widescreen issues, screen flickering, and black screen loading issues.
Compatibility and control issues: The game has mixed compatibility reports, running well on some devices like the Steam Deck and low-end laptops, but lacking controller support and having window focus issues.

Performance varies significantly across hardware cohorts, with higher VRAM configurations generally reporting smoother experiences but still facing optimization issues. Lower VRAM setups struggle more with frame drops, black screens, and overheating.
Windows 12-15GB VRAM: mixed. Users report a mix of smooth gameplay and significant optimization issues, including frame rate drops and GPU overutilization.
Windows <8GB VRAM / 16-31GB RAM: mixed. Experiences vary with frequent mentions of black screens and frame drops, but some users find the gameplay enjoyable despite these issues.
Windows <8GB VRAM / <16GB RAM: negative. Users frequently report performance issues such as lag, black screens, and overheating, significantly impacting the gaming experience.
Steam Deck: The analysis of user feedback reveals significant technical barriers and issues affecting the Steam Deck experience. Key problems include poor controller and UI adaptation, frequent screen issues such as black screens and flickering, performance and optimization issues, game crashes, and save issues. These problems collectively impact the user experience, requiring tinkering and workarounds to enjoy the game.
Linux and Proton: The game has notable performance issues on Linux, particularly on the Steam Deck. While it can run, optimization is lacking, leading to framerate drops and other performance problems.
